Aero Prologo Predator//02 saddle will get regular rails for TT & Tri
Since we first wrote about Pogačar’s Predator saddle in 2024’s Tour time trial, its official 01 debut the next spring, then Vingegaard’s grippier saddle for the 2025 Tour TT saddle, it was nonetheless an ultra-proprietary, out-of-reach design requiring a particular seatpost and costing greater than 1200€. Now, Prologo makes it way more common as Predator//02 with replaceable oval carbon rails.
And most significantly, a 680€ value reduce.


Look, the brand new Predator 2 remains to be shockingly costly at 570€ for a inventory saddle. However in order for you essentially the most aero perch in your time trial or triathlon bike, this seems to be your probability to journey the identical saddle as Grand Tour winners.
What’s new?


The Predator saddle form is strictly the identical – from its lengthy, skinny padded prime to the underlying carbon shell with its aerodynamic prolonged tail. However the truth is, the brand new model strikes to an injected long-fiber carbon base (as an alternative of hand-laid fiber) that manages to chop prices with out including a lot weight.
Beneath, Prologo has swapped out the flat carbon plate for a modular replaceable 7x9mm oval Nack carbon rail system. Meaning it would match any saddle suitable with oval rails.


The brand new saddle is available in two variations, each sharing the identical 260x110mm general dimensions:
Predator//02TT with thinner padding in direction of the again and a slim 50mm extensive nostril – 159g
Predator//02TRI with tall padding from entrance to again, and a wider, extra cushioned 60mm nostril – 169g
Prologo Dimension R2 3D flat saddle for highway, gravel & XC


Plus, Prologo added a third saddle to their 3D-printed padding household with the Dimension 3D. It encompasses a extra standard cowl, doubtlessly higher suited to a wider vary of cyclists, particularly off-road riders.
The flat V-shaped saddle consists of the identical wider 40mm nostril of the opposite 2nd-gen Dimension saddles, a big PAS central stress reduction cutout, and now variable-density Multi Sector System 3D-printed padding for extra rider consolation.
This form was particularly optimized for use throughout all efficiency biking disciplines, which is why Prologo reimagined how one can give it a brand new sort of 3D-printed padding prime with an built-in cowl…




As an alternative of sticking with the identical utterly open honeycomb grid, the Dimension R2 3D encompasses a mostly-closed cowl developed to maintain extra filth, mud & grit out of the construction. Whereas open padding can often be cleaned by flushing grime & particles out, grit like sand can stick inside.


The brand new Dimension R2 3D is available in only one dimension – 245mm lengthy x 143mm extensive – and encompasses a long-fiber carbon-reinforced nylon shell. It’s accessible with both oval 7×9.3mm Nack carbon rails at 195g, or standard 7mm spherical tubular metal TIROX rails at ~228g.
Just like the Scratch 3D & Nago 3D, the brand new Dimension 3D ought to promote for roughly 290€ with metal rails or 390€ with carbon rails – a big pricing premium in comparison with the conventionally-padded Dimension saddles.
Nago EVA high-performance girls’s saddle


Prologo additionally expands its top-tier girls’s saddle line with the brand new Nago Eva. It joins the Dimension Eva & Scratch Eva to mix Prologo’s traditional saddle shapes tweaked for top-level feminine riders.
The hallmark of the Nago Eva saddle is a hidden stress reduction cutout within the shell, lined by a really low-density foam within the central part to restrict any stress on delicate tissue. Padding on the edges beneath the sit bones is thicker and far greater density to supply steady assist.


Like the opposite two Eva saddles, the brand new Nago Eva is out there with both oval Nack carbon rails for 229€ or metal rails for 129€.
Octotouch 3D grippy bar tape


Prologo additionally provides a brand new injection-molded Octotouch 3D bar tape, with their signature grippy dots for higher consolation and management, particularly in foul climate or over tough terrain.
The outer floor of the bartape is a skinny, rubbery elastomer with raised CPC-style nodules molded in, backed by a skinny EVA foam for cushioning. The idea is just about the identical as Prologo’s earlier Onetouch 3D bartape, however right here the little dots are a bigger diameter, with slits reduce throughout them so that they deform extra beneath your hand.
“The reduce current on every of the conical constructions will increase breathability and the sensation of softness on the palm of the hand, whereas on the similar time permitting moisture to simply escape… Furthermore, this expertise manages to remodel vibrations coming from the bottom into a fragile micromassage that relieves the bicycle owner’s palms, wrists, and arms, growing stamina ranges within the physique.“
Formally, the brand new 55€ Octotouch 3D tape is similar 3.5mm general thickness because the Onetouch, apparently together with the peak of the grippers. However it looks as if the brand new tape encompasses a thinner base and the nubbins are a bit taller, making the brand new tape really feel thinner general. It additionally makes this new tape lighter – 118g for the complete 2m lengthy x 30mm extensive roll (sufficient to wrap each side of your bar), a financial savings of just about 10% over the Onetouch 3D tape.
MIG Air CPC aero, grippy half-finger biking gloves


We already wrote concerning the aero advantages of the brand new MIG Air gloves. However their tiny CPC grippers are price a more in-depth look. Those self same tubular Join Energy Management nubs are smaller than ever in these new aero gloves, composed of a wide range of sizes and spacing concentric across the heart of your palm to enhance grip on the bars whereas damping vibrations.
